If a golf vacation in Ireland has a downside (and it is just a small one), it is that the most highly regarded courses in Ireland tend to be spread out all around the coastline of the island.
If you are thinking about a trip of 6-8 days, I would suggest concentrating on just one or two areas.
The courses worth playing in each area would include:
,
Dublin: Portmarnock, the Island, the European Club (about 30 miles south of Dublin) & County Louth (aka Baltray, about 30-40 miles north of Dublin).
Southwest: Killarney, Waterville, Ballybunion & Lahinch
West Coast: County Sligo (aka Rosses Point), Carne (aka Belmullet) & Enniscrone
Northwest: Ballyliffin, Rosapenna, Narin & Portnoo (there are a couple of others I cannot recall)
Northern Ireland: County Down, Portrush, Portstewart & Castlerock
